Neighbourhoods

It’s the city’s playground, and it has a lot going on! The Temple Bar area is a square on the south bank of the River Liffey with off-shooting streets and narrow laneways. They’re lined with boutiques, cafes, galleries, and pubs, and at any time of year, packed with culture-vultures and party-seekers.

Dublin’s rare examples of Scottish sandstone. The interior, which was once the main banking hall, is a stunning example of merchant power and patronage displaying an extraordinary ornate setting, stained glass ceiling, mosaic-tiled floors, and spectacular hand-carved plasterwork and cornicing. If you ramble downstairs to the nether regions you will find the vaults. Look at our Chatwood safes, now retained as a museum-type feature.

Consejos para los viajeros

Desplazamientos

By foot is the fastest way to get around!

If your intention is to enjoy the city, a walk is the best way to get around... otherwise if your plan includes the countryside Dart and Busses are the best options.
Costumbres y cultura

Dublin is a cultural universe.

Buskers, street artists, open-air markets and exhibitions a create carnival atmosphere. You can catch a show (no less than three theatres on offer), mosey through a gallery, explore a market, go to a gig or just plonk yourself in a café for Dublin’s best people-watching spot.
Qué meter en la maleta

Casual vibe

Ireland has a casual vibe in most places. Unless you’re planning for a very special occasion, there’s no need to pack fancy. Light sweater (packable is best so you can shove it in a bag when no longer needed) Layers (wool base layers are the best) Extra socks –no one wants cold, wet feet- 4-7 pair underwear 4-7 pair socks 1-2 jeans or pants 3-5 t-shirts (lightweight and great for layering) 2 long sleeve outer layer tops or sweatshirts 1-2 skirts or dresses (depending on the season) Rain jacket (longer than usual) Umbrella Hat, scarf, gloves Warm jacket with a hood
